package org.apache.hadoop.yarn.server.resourcemanager.scheduler;
import java.util.List;
import java.util.Set;
import org.apache.hadoop.classification.InterfaceAudience.LimitedPrivate;
import org.apache.hadoop.classification.InterfaceStability.Evolving;
import org.apache.hadoop.security.UserGroupInformation;
import org.apache.hadoop.yarn.api.records.Priority;
import org.apache.hadoop.yarn.api.records.QueueACL;
import org.apache.hadoop.yarn.api.records.QueueInfo;
import org.apache.hadoop.yarn.api.records.QueueUserACLInfo;
import org.apache.hadoop.yarn.api.records.Resource;
import org.apache.hadoop.yarn.server.resourcemanager.rmcontainer.RMContainer;
@Evolving
@LimitedPrivate("yarn")
public interface Queue {
/**
* Get the queue name
* @return queue name
*/
String getQueueName();
/**
* Get the queue metrics
* @return the queue metrics
*/
QueueMetrics getMetrics();
/**
* Get queue information
* @param includeChildQueues include child queues?
* @param recursive recursively get child queue information?
* @return queue information
*/
QueueInfo getQueueInfo(boolean includeChildQueues, boolean recursive);
/**
* Get queue ACLs for given <code>user</code>.
* @param user username
* @return queue ACLs for user
*/
List<QueueUserACLInfo> getQueueUserAclInfo(UserGroupInformation user);
boolean hasAccess(QueueACL acl, UserGroupInformation user);
public AbstractUsersManager getAbstractUsersManager();
/**
* Recover the state of the queue for a given container.
* @param clusterResource the resource of the cluster
* @param schedulerAttempt the application for which the container was allocated
* @param rmContainer the container that was recovered.
*/
public void recoverContainer(Resource clusterResource,
SchedulerApplicationAttempt schedulerAttempt, RMContainer rmContainer);
/**
* Get labels can be accessed of this queue
* labels={*}, means this queue can access any label
* labels={ }, means this queue cannot access any label except node without label
* labels={a, b, c} means this queue can access a or b or c
* @return labels
*/
public Set<String> getAccessibleNodeLabels();
/**
* Get default label expression of this queue. If label expression of
* ApplicationSubmissionContext and label expression of Resource Request not
* set, this will be used.
*
* @return default label expression
*/
public String getDefaultNodeLabelExpression();
/**
* When new outstanding resource is asked, calling this will increase pending
* resource in a queue.
*
* @param nodeLabel asked by application
* @param resourceToInc new resource asked
*/
public void incPendingResource(String nodeLabel, Resource resourceToInc);
/**
* When an outstanding resource is fulfilled or canceled, calling this will
* decrease pending resource in a queue.
*
* @param nodeLabel
* asked by application
* @param resourceToDec
* new resource asked
*/
public void decPendingResource(String nodeLabel, Resource resourceToDec);
/**
* Get the Default Application Priority for this queue
*
* @return default application priority
*/
public Priority getDefaultApplicationPriority();
/**
* Increment Reserved Capacity
*
* @param partition
* asked by application
* @param reservedRes
* reserved resource asked
*/
public void incReservedResource(String partition, Resource reservedRes);
/**
* Decrement Reserved Capacity
*
* @param partition
* asked by application
* @param reservedRes
* reserved resource asked
*/
public void decReservedResource(String partition, Resource reservedRes);
}
